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1202268263 680620 5823761 92989
40028410 7956409 5420553
40028410 7956409 5420553
50 992 85 392 082853
All about undefined
Interested in learning more?
40028410 7956409 5420553
50 992 85 392 082853
See more
087151 095740
097 2242583 4496971
See more
3044 1247029
6779819 40333978208 0655048 1400 7879
See more